This Year's Model Updates:

For 2009 the Kia Sedona receives standard satellite radio and a USB/MP3 input jack, plus an optional navigation system for the EX trim.

Pros:
  • Perfect crash test scores, long warranty coverage, solid value, available short-wheelbase model, quiet ride.
Cons:
  • Short-wheelbase model lacks foldaway third-row seat, spotty interior materials quality.

  • Sedona Du Jour - 2009 Kia Sedona
    By -

    I drove this vehicle under all conditions on all kinds of roads rangine from sea level to 10,000 and found it to be much better than expected. I carried heavy loads that frequently approached maximum design limits. This minivan did very well as a cargo and people carrier. Passengers were surprised by the quiet, composed ride, even at 80mph. One friend, after we were under way at night on CA S.R. 14 had to ask what make the vehicle was. He just didnt expect the smooth, quiet ride he was getting. Head and cross-winds didnt bother it much. Torrential rains and temps. from 20 to 105F were handled well. Kept up well with an RX-9 up Tioga Pass from US 395. Very well balanced.

  • Great van with little problems - 2009 Kia Sedona
    By -

    I bought this van in 4/10 as a new 09 and got a great deal. Ride quality is nice, the engine is smooth, quiet, and powerful, and the interior is well though out with the exception of the armrests, which are mounted too low on the seats. So far its only got 1600 miles on it, as we mainly use it for family outings and not day to day driving. In that time its been back to the dealer twice because the check engine light came two different times and the battery died once. Kia roadside assistance picked it up when the battery died, and both of the check engine lights turned out to be sensor problems. Hopefully all that is sorted out. I love the van, but not the hassle its been so far.

  • But I dont want a minivan! - 2009 Kia Sedona
    By -

    I am a reluctant minivan buyer. With two kids still in car seats, my wife felt it was the way to go. She was right. Plenty of room, nice 3rd row folding seats, comfort, and easy to drive. The Kia came with some nice features such as the iPod dock and good storage cubbies. The ability to roll down the back seat windows for the kids is nice too. The V6 has some good pep when needed as well. Turns out I am pleasantly surprised that I actually enjoy driving the Sedona. It’s still a van, but it’s nice to know I’ve got a highly rated vehicle for safety with two small kids. Yes, Kia has a low resale value, but that allowed me to buy this for $15k. It was a great buy.
